Westwood Ho! Beach Devon

-NA- ,United Kingdom
Westwood Ho! Beach Devon Westwood Ho! Beach Devon is one of the popular Public & Government Service located in , listed under Local business in -NA- , Hotel in -NA- , Region in -NA- , Public Services & Government in -NA- ,

Contact Details & Working Hours

Map of Westwood Ho! Beach Devon